LadyBug Birthday!


I made this card a while ago for my sister-in-law's birthday, I just never got a chance to post it, so I am now.
ALL paper is from The Paper Company's Value Packs.

I started out with a piece of 8 1/2" x 5 1/2" brown cardstock, and folded it in half for the base of my card.  For my first layer I used a piece of black cardstock cut at 5 1/4" x 4".  I then layered a piece of light blue cardstock cut at 2 1/2" x 3 3/4" on the top half of the black and a piece of green cardstock cut at 2" x 3 3/4" on the bottom half of the black, I attached them both using my ATG gun.  Then I wrapped a piece of brown grosgrain ribbon around the whole thing to cover the "seem" where the two pieces met and secured it on the back using regular Scotch tape.   Then I used my ATG gun to attach the whole thing to the base of the card.

I cut my ladybug at 3 1/2" from the "Create a Critter" cartridge using my Cricut Expression.  I attached it to the card using 3-D Dots.  The sun I cut at 1 1/2" also from the "Create a Critter" cartridge, and attached it with a 3-D Dot as well.

To finish off my card I used a stamp from My Pink Stamper's Birthday Crazy set for my sentiment with a Stampin' Up! Classic Chocolate Chip stamp pad.
